Practical Steps for Intent Setting
Setting intentions should be an empowering experience, not a source of stress. Here are some actionable steps to help guide this process:
- Visualize Your Goals: Spend time imagining how your intentions will manifest in your life. Try to vividly picture not just what you want, but how you want to feel in the process.
- Write It Down: Documenting intentions makes them more concrete. Create a vision board or a journal entry that expresses your plans and goals for the year.
- Connect with Others: Share your intentions with friends or family members for added accountability. Discussing your hopes for the year can help clarify them further.
- Review Regularly: Setting intentions is not a one-off action. Schedule regular check-ins to assess your progress and adjust your plans as needed.
